Flo

Poor Flo was found by a member of the public and taken into a local vets when they were concerned for her welfare. Her fur was very patchy and she was very very frightened. Over time she has blossomed into a beautiful girl with bags more confidence than the cat we first met. After lots of TLC from her foster mum and some flea treatment her fur has all grown back nicely. She may be a little shy at first but as you can see from her video she is adorable and flicks her tail at you in delight! She’d make a wonderful family pet but perhaps children of a minimum of primary school age would be best. She could be ok with a placid dog and another cat but we’d encourage anyone who may be interested in this black panther to get in touch so we can discuss her needs.
